void类型占用多少字节
说说Java的native关键字?Java的native关键字用于表示一个方法的实现是由底层的本地代码提供的,而不是Java代码实现的。因此,该方法的实现在编译时并不会被包含在生成的Java字节码中,在使用native关键字声明一个方法时,该方法只包含方法签名,而没有方法体,例如:publicnativevoidmyMethod();这里的myMethod()方法只有方法签名,没有方法体。
1、C语言中abc\0defgh占多少字节?#includevoidmain(){printf(%d,sizeof(abc\0defgh));}在VC6.0中用测字节函数sizeof即可。例如,对abc\0defgh这个字符串,数起来共有9个字符,但实际上占用10个字节,这是因为系统自动在字符串最后加一个字符串结束标志\0,而它也是要占用一个字节的。sizeof还可以用来测各种数据类型内存分配的字节数。
sizeof(int)),系统会输出4。(我用的编译系统是VC的,至于TC中这个函数是否也可以用这个函数就不知道了)\33abcdef中,\33代表一个ASCII码值为33的字符,在内存中占用一个字节。在内存中占用10个字节,其中的\\在C语言中相当于\,在内存中占用一个字节。类似的有%%代表%。
2、C 中的变量类型都有哪些,各占多少字节?主要记得三种一,整型int2Bytesignedint2Byteunsignedint4Bytelongint4Byte二.实型float4Bytedouble8Bytelongdouble16Byte三.字符型char1Byte。变量的三要素:类型,符号,数值。intnum3;int*anum;(错误,因为变量a的类型是int*,而num的类型是int)。
*a
除非注明,文章均由 白起网络 整理发布,欢迎转载。